DANGER

Long hours of using the appliance can 
cause circulation problems in the hands on 
account of vibrations.

It is not possible to specify a generally valid 
operation time, since this depends on sev-
eral factors:
– Proneness to blood circulation deficien-

cies (cold, numb fingers).

– Low ambient temperature. Wear warm 

gloves to protect hands.

– A firm grip impedes blood circulation.
– Continuous operation is worse than an 

operation interrupted by pauses.

In case of regular, long-term operation of 
the device and in case of repeated occur-
rence of the symptoms (e.g. cold, numb fin-
gers) please consult a physician.

WARNING

The water jet that is emitted from the high-
pressure nozzle results in a repulsion pow-

er acting on the hand spray gun. Make sure 
that you have a firm footing and are also 
holding the hand spray gun and spray lance 
firmly.
